ST. LOUIS - Motorists who drive northbound Route 141 north of Lakefront Dr. will have to take an alternate route for the next few months. Crews will close all northbound lanes starting at 7 a.m. Tuesday, March 7 through June to replace the bridge over the Earth City Levee District’s retention ponds.
During construction, signed detours will be in place. Drivers who normally use this section of Route 141, north of I-70, will be detoured to eastbound I-70 to northbound I-270 to westbound 370 and to Route 141.
Once the new northbound Route 141 bridge is open to traffic, construction of the southbound Route 141 bridge will begin.
